Let’s get Started:

Cream Card Base: 5.25 x 10.5, scored and folded at 5.25

Gold Border Layer: 5 x 5

Cream Border Layer 4.25 x 4.25

Green Card Face: 4 x 4

Card Face:

  • I dusted the card face liberally with anti-static powder.

  • I laid the card face on the grip mat and positioned the portion of the stencil that contained the wreath.

  • I pressed my Versamark embossing pad through the stencil, going over each area a couple of timew to make sure I had good coverage.

  • After removing the stencil, I sprinkled a pale green embossing powder over the card face and set it with my heat gun after shaking off the excess powder.

  • I returned the stencil to the card face, positioning it to correctly place the berries on the wreath.

  • I used my embossing pen to fill in the circles in this section.

  • I sprinkled red embossing powder over the card face and shook off the excess before heat-setting it.


Other:

  • I die cut the Holy Family from the center of the piece of gold cardstock used to create the border.**

**see Cheating on Layers and Borders under Stretch Your Pennies in the header

Assembly


  • I centered and glued the gold border to the card base.

  • I repeated this with the cream border layer and then the green card face.

  • I glued the die cut in place.

  • I added a tiny gold pearl to the center of the star.
